How do I create a golden grahams ice cream cake?

You'll need

  • Golden Grahams cereal 2 cups for the crust, 1 cup for layers
  • Butter 4 tablespoons, melted
  • Ice cream of your choice 4 cups, softened

1

Prepare the Golden Grahams crust

In a ziplock bag, crush 2 cups of Golden Grahams cereal until you have fine crumbs. Mix the crumbs with 4 tablespoons of melted butter. Press the mixture into the bottom of a greased 9-inch springform pan to form the crust.

2

The creamy ice cream layer

Take out your favorite ice cream flavor and let it soften for a few minutes. Scoop 2 cups of the softened ice cream onto the Golden Grahams crust. Smooth it out evenly using a spatula.

3

Add a layer of Grahams

Sprinkle a layer of crushed Golden Grahams cereal (about 1/2 cup) over the ice cream. Press gently to ensure it sticks to the ice cream layer.

4

Repeat with more ice cream

Scoop another 2 cups of softened ice cream on top of the Golden Grahams layer. Smooth it out evenly again.

5

Final Grahams and freeze

Sprinkle another layer of crushed Golden Grahams cereal (about 1/2 cup) over the ice cream. Press gently. Cover the cake with plastic wrap and freeze for at least 4 hours or until firm.

6

Serve and enjoy!

Remove the cake from the freezer. Let it sit at room temperature for a few minutes. Unlock the springform pan and carefully remove the sides. Slice and serve your marvelous Golden Grahams Ice Cream Cake to your adoring guests!
